Haha, those pics just about made my day. Lol

But, whatever you want to do depends upon what you want to mod your truck to be like. I would definitely do something. If the grille is the same stuff as the bumper top piece, I'd go without a grille/bumper before having those. IMO, it just puts off your truck as the bottom line Dodge. Nothing done to it, but a base line truck. Going all white would look pretty sweet. I haven't seen those bumpers up close, but my brother once showed me something sweet on a Chevy forum. It was with the dash, but it was about how to remove your dash, sand it down, then paint it. If the bumper isn't smooth, sanding it down then painting it would add 100% to it, IMO once again. That would make it basically the same fascia as what other Dodges have.
But, if you want to go like Semigod, or another member who has a white and black truck, then I'd just look around at some other things, and don't make it all white. Just like my truck, it has too much chrome on it, so I can't theme it dark/grey/black, just because of that fact. So think how you want your truck to look when complete.
